diff --git a/ui/src/app/extension/extensions-forms/extension-form-mqtt.tpl.html b/ui/src/app/extension/extensions-forms/extension-form-mqtt.tpl.html
index 6c0ab90..f972b78 100644
--- a/ui/src/app/extension/extensions-forms/extension-form-mqtt.tpl.html
+++ b/ui/src/app/extension/extensions-forms/extension-form-mqtt.tpl.html
@@ -241,14 +241,14 @@
</md-input-container>
<md-input-container ng-if="map.converter.typeExp == 'deviceTypeJsonExpression'" flex="60" class="md-block" md-is-error="theForm['mqttJsonTypeExp_' + brokerIndex + mapIndex].$touched && theForm['mqttJsonTypeExp_' + brokerIndex + mapIndex].$invalid">
<label translate>extension.json-type-expression</label>
- <input required name="mqttJsonTypeExp_{{brokerIndex}}{{mapIndex}}" ng-model="map.converter.deviceTypeJsonExpression">
+ <input name="mqttJsonTypeExp_{{brokerIndex}}{{mapIndex}}" ng-model="map.converter.deviceTypeJsonExpression">
<div ng-messages="theForm['mqttJsonTypeExp_' + brokerIndex + mapIndex].$error">
<div translate ng-message="required">extension.field-required</div>
</div>
</md-input-container>
<md-input-container ng-if="map.converter.typeExp == 'deviceTypeTopicExpression'" flex="60" class="md-block" md-is-error="theForm['mqttTopicTypeExp_' + brokerIndex + mapIndex].$touched && theForm['mqttTopicTypeExp_' + brokerIndex + mapIndex].$invalid">
<label translate>extension.topic-type-expression</label>
- <input required name="mqttTopicTypeExp_{{brokerIndex}}{{mapIndex}}" ng-model="map.converter.deviceTypeTopicExpression">
+ <input name="mqttTopicTypeExp_{{brokerIndex}}{{mapIndex}}" ng-model="map.converter.deviceTypeTopicExpression">
<div ng-messages="theForm['mqttTopicTypeExp_' + brokerIndex + mapIndex].$error">
<div translate ng-message="required">extension.field-required</div>
</div>